MUNDAY- Studio wedding group; bride and four women in big 'picrure' hats and high necked lacy dresses. Two bridesmaids in lace hats and frilled dresses. Assortment of brooches, pearl necklace, chains.
MUNYARD - studio portrait of bride and groom. Good examples of bar brooch with pendant, large (locket?) pendant on chain. Groom wearing button boots. Style Ca 1910.
W.CASEY. Studio portrait of bride and groom. bridal gown with tassle detail on bodice and graduated tucking in panel in front of skirt. Train on dress with mid length veil.
BATH & JOHNSTON - Studio wedding group with two brides ((sisters/twins) wearing identical clothing. Two elderly women wearing complete black outfits. two flower girls with flower cane baskets. Two large feathered hats.
Armless Abraham, man with beard and hat with a stick tucked under his arm, standing by a small cart of wood drawn by three goats in harness. Background of heath-like bush.
Large crowd standing around the rim of empty reservoir
watching water emerging from a large pipe. Marquee, bunting and flags by official group. Occasion was the first water to come to the Goldfields from the pipeline. SirJohn Forrest and Lady Forrest in attendance.
